SPINAL DECOMPRESSION

The primary indications for intersegmental spinal traction are intervertebral disc protrusions, degenerating discs, joint hypomobility, spinal nerve root impingement, and muscle spasms.  This treatment can be an alternative to surgery.  It gently stretches the spine, relieving pressure from the discs, joints, and muscles, while enhancing the body’s natural healing processes.  This traction promotes tissue lengthening, proper joint alignment, and functional stability of the low back and neck.
